wav2letter is an automatic speech recognition toolkit and deep learning framework designed to convert audio speech signals into written text. It functions as a distributed training system and an inference engine for building and deploying neural network architectures. The system enables the training of large-scale speech models across multiple compute nodes using custom architecture files and structured recipes.
